Greenfingers Guides: Fruit and Vegetables by Lucy Summers

Cheap, ethical and organic, the idea of growing your own fruit and vegetables is becoming increasingly popular. However it isn't always easy to know which plants will thrive in your garden, or how best to look after them. With easy-to-follow information, this book allows you to tell at a glance which fruit and vegetables would be most suited to you and your garden situation. Profiles for each plant contain useful, practical cultivation advice that will encourage gardeners to grow with ever-greater enjoyment, creativity and confidence. Comprehensive, richly illustrated and written with the gardening novice or occasional gardener in mind, this is the perfect handbook for anyone looking to start growing their own fruit and vegetables as well as offering a useful reference for more experienced gardeners. A successful model in the 80s, Lucy co-hosted Countdown before becoming Good Morning's home expert and presenting ITV's Homegrown gardening series. Lucy now runs a successful landscape design partnership with projects undertaken for clients worldwide and has staged award-winning gardens at the Chelsea Flower Show. She regularly contributes gardening articles to a variety of publications and was the gardening correspondent for Ideal Home magazine. She also lectures on gardening subjects.
